21st Artys Planned For April 8

The Artys, presented by the Mobile Arts Council (MAC), will be held on April 8 at 6-9 p.m. at the Renaissance Riverview Plaza Hotel in Mobile. It will feature a catered dinner, a cash bar and the Jimmy Roebuck Trio’s live music. City of Mobile Poet Laureate Huggy Bear da Poet will recite a poem he has written for MAC, and there will be performances by Mobile Opera and Mobile Ballet. This year, the Artys will honor Daniela Pardo; LeaAyn Shurley; Muffinjaw Designs; Danielle Juzan; Patrick Jacobs; Carter Hale, Jr.; Eva Golson; Alfred Ward; Jodie Cain Smith; Eric Erdman; the Chickasaw Civic Theatre; Joe and Donna Camp; Brian Tan; and Stan Hackney. This year’s Arty awards, which are always an original work of art from a local artist, were created by Marshall OHern, a multimedia artist whose whimsical, colorful creations span from woodcarving to vinyl to colored pencils and digital renderings. Tickets are $65 in advance and $75 at the door. Table reservations are also available.
